Visa cancellation can be a stressful, especially when you are unaware of the grace period. Every visa type in the United Arab Emirates (UAE) has a specific grace period for visa cancellation. The grace period is the time given to individuals to stay in the country legally after their visa has been cancelled online.

Step 1: Determine Your Visa Type

The first step in checking your visa cancellation grace period is to determine your visa type. The UAE offers various types of visas, including tourist visas, residency visas, and work visas. Each visa type has a different grace period for visa cancellation. If you are unsure of your visa type, you can check your passport or residency permit for the visa information.

Step 2: Visit the General Directorate of Residency and Foreigners Affairs (GDRFA) Website

Once you have determined your visa type, the next step is to visit the General Directorate of Residency and Foreigners Affairs (GDRFA) website. The GDRFA is the government agency responsible for managing visas and immigration in the UAE. The website provides a range of services for visa holders, including checking your visa cancellation grace period.

Step 3: Click on the "Services" Tab

After accessing the GDRFA website, click on the "Services" tab located on the top menu bar. This will lead you to a drop-down menu with various options.

Step 4: Select the "Visa Services" Option

From the "Services" drop-down menu, select the "Visa Services" option. This will redirect you to the visa services page where you can access a range of visa-related services.

Step 5: Click on the "Inquiry and Follow-up on Cancelled Residence Visas" Option

Once on the visa services page, click on the "Inquiry and Follow-up on Cancelled Residence Visas" option. This service allows individuals to check the status of their cancelled residence visas, including the grace period for visa cancellation.

Step 6: Enter Your Details

After clicking on the "Inquiry and Follow-up on Cancelled Residence Visas" option, you will be directed to a page where you can enter your details. You will be required to enter your residency file number, date of birth, and nationality. Once you have entered your details, click on the "Submit" button.

Step 7: Check Your Grace Period

After submitting your details, the system will display your visa information, including the grace period for visa cancellation. You can also check the status of your visa and other details related to your visa on this page.
